why do TB suck?

first why they suck on the street, they have very large tread bocks that are twice as large as almost any other tire. while this may be OK when it's dry out, in the rain they handle simmilar to a racing slick. not to mention they are loud, wear like crap, and are overly expensive.

offroad, they suck for the same reason. those large tread blocks don't get much grip on rocks and are so close together thay don't allow mud to escape. turning them further into slicks. i suppose if you have a tire tread cutter you could sipe them yourself but why on earth would you want to pay all that money just to invest a ton of time trying to make work?

and to top it all off, they are bias ply. on cold mornings they'll have a flat spot and be loud as hell(and wear all phucked up).
